* TList -> TFPList to match latest changes in fcl-passrc

git-svn-id: trunk@19669 -
This commit is contained in:
michael 2011-11-22 18:15:28 +00:00
parent 6cb6569d51
commit bb54f1375c
4 changed files with 21 additions and 21 deletions

View File

@ -173,7 +173,7 @@ type
// Assumes a list of TObject instances and frees them on destruction // Assumes a list of TObject instances and frees them on destruction
TObjectList = class(TList) TObjectList = class(TFPList)
public public
destructor Destroy; override; destructor Destroy; override;
end; end;
@ -271,7 +271,7 @@ type
DescrDocNames: TStringList; // Names of the XML documents DescrDocNames: TStringList; // Names of the XML documents
FRootLinkNode: TLinkNode; FRootLinkNode: TLinkNode;
FRootDocNode: TDocNode; FRootDocNode: TDocNode;
FPackages: TList; // List of TFPPackage objects FPackages: TFPList; // List of TFPPackage objects
CurModule: TPasModule; CurModule: TPasModule;
CurPackageDocNode: TDocNode; CurPackageDocNode: TDocNode;
public public
@ -554,7 +554,7 @@ begin
FRootDocNode := TDocNode.Create('', nil); FRootDocNode := TDocNode.Create('', nil);
HidePrivate := True; HidePrivate := True;
InterfaceOnly:=True; InterfaceOnly:=True;
FPackages := TList.Create; FPackages := TFPList.Create;
end; end;
destructor TFPDocEngine.Destroy; destructor TFPDocEngine.Destroy;
@ -696,7 +696,7 @@ var
result:=Copy(AName, DotPos2 + 1, length(AName)-dotpos2); result:=Copy(AName, DotPos2 + 1, length(AName)-dotpos2);
end; end;
function SearchInList(clslist:TList;s:string):TPasElement; function SearchInList(clslist:TFPList;s:string):TPasElement;
var i : integer; var i : integer;
ClassEl: TPasElement; ClassEl: TPasElement;
begin begin
@ -1084,7 +1084,7 @@ function TFPDocEngine.FindElement(const AName: String): TPasElement;
function FindInModule(AModule: TPasModule; const LocalName: String): TPasElement; function FindInModule(AModule: TPasModule; const LocalName: String): TPasElement;
var var
l: TList; l: TFPList;
i: Integer; i: Integer;
begin begin
@ -1181,7 +1181,7 @@ function TFPDocEngine.ResolveLink(AModule: TPasModule;
var var
i: Integer; i: Integer;
ThisPackage: TLinkNode; ThisPackage: TLinkNode;
UnitList: TList; UnitList: TFPList;
function CanWeExit(AResult: string): boolean; function CanWeExit(AResult: string): boolean;
var var
@ -1422,7 +1422,7 @@ function TFPDocEngine.FindDocNode(ARefModule: TPasModule;
const AName: String): TDocNode; const AName: String): TDocNode;
var var
CurPackage: TDocNode; CurPackage: TDocNode;
UnitList: TList; UnitList: TFPList;
i: Integer; i: Integer;
begin begin
if Length(AName) = 0 then if Length(AName) = 0 then

View File

@ -503,7 +503,7 @@ constructor THTMLWriter.Create(APackage: TPasPackage; AEngine: TFPDocEngine);
end; end;
procedure AddPages(AElement: TPasElement; ASubpageIndex: Integer; procedure AddPages(AElement: TPasElement; ASubpageIndex: Integer;
AList: TList); AList: TFPList);
var var
i: Integer; i: Integer;
begin begin
@ -1507,7 +1507,7 @@ function THTMLWriter.AppendHyperlink(Parent: TDOMNode;
Element: TPasElement): TDOMElement; Element: TPasElement): TDOMElement;
var var
s: String; s: String;
UnitList: TList; UnitList: TFPList;
i: Integer; i: Integer;
ThisPackage: TLinkNode; ThisPackage: TLinkNode;
begin begin
@ -2346,7 +2346,7 @@ end;
procedure THTMLWriter.AddModuleIdentifiers(AModule : TPasModule; L : TStrings); procedure THTMLWriter.AddModuleIdentifiers(AModule : TPasModule; L : TStrings);
Procedure AddElementsFromList(L : TStrings; List : TList); Procedure AddElementsFromList(L : TStrings; List : TFPList);
Var Var
I : Integer; I : Integer;
@ -2539,12 +2539,12 @@ procedure THTMLWriter.CreateModulePageBody(AModule: TPasModule;
end; end;
end; end;
procedure CreateSimpleSubpage(const ATitle: DOMString; AList: TList); procedure CreateSimpleSubpage(const ATitle: DOMString; AList: TFPList);
var var
TableEl, TREl, TDEl, CodeEl: TDOMElement; TableEl, TREl, TDEl, CodeEl: TDOMElement;
i, j: Integer; i, j: Integer;
Decl: TPasElement; Decl: TPasElement;
SortedList: TList; SortedList: TFPList;
DocNode: TDocNode; DocNode: TDocNode;
S : String; S : String;
@ -2552,7 +2552,7 @@ procedure THTMLWriter.CreateModulePageBody(AModule: TPasModule;
AppendMenuBar(ASubpageIndex); AppendMenuBar(ASubpageIndex);
S:=ATitle; S:=ATitle;
AppendTitle(Format(SDocUnitTitle + ': %s', [AModule.Name, S])); AppendTitle(Format(SDocUnitTitle + ': %s', [AModule.Name, S]));
SortedList := TList.Create; SortedList := TFPList.Create;
try try
for i := 0 to AList.Count - 1 do for i := 0 to AList.Count - 1 do
begin begin
@ -3125,13 +3125,13 @@ var
procedure CreateSortedSubpage(AFilter: TMemberFilter); procedure CreateSortedSubpage(AFilter: TMemberFilter);
var var
List: TList; List: TFPList;
ThisClass: TPasClassType; ThisClass: TPasClassType;
i, j: Integer; i, j: Integer;
Member: TPasElement; Member: TPasElement;
TableEl, TREl, TDEl, ParaEl, LinkEl: TDOMElement; TableEl, TREl, TDEl, ParaEl, LinkEl: TDOMElement;
begin begin
List := TList.Create; List := TFPList.Create;
try try
ThisClass := AClass; ThisClass := AClass;
while True do while True do

View File

@ -91,7 +91,7 @@ Type
procedure WriteManRef(APasElement : TPasElement; Comma : Boolean); procedure WriteManRef(APasElement : TPasElement; Comma : Boolean);
procedure WriteModuleSeealso(Comma : Boolean); procedure WriteModuleSeealso(Comma : Boolean);
procedure SortElementList(List : TList); procedure SortElementList(List : TFPList);
Function GetDescrString(AContext: TPasElement; DescrNode: TDOMElement) : String; Function GetDescrString(AContext: TPasElement; DescrNode: TDOMElement) : String;
function ConstValue(ConstDecl: TPasConst): String; virtual; function ConstValue(ConstDecl: TPasConst): String; virtual;
procedure WriteCommentLine; procedure WriteCommentLine;
@ -192,7 +192,7 @@ constructor TManWriter.Create(APackage: TPasPackage; AEngine: TFPDocEngine);
Engine.AddLink(AElement.PathName, ElementToManPage(AElement)); Engine.AddLink(AElement.PathName, ElementToManPage(AElement));
end; end;
procedure AddList(AElement: TPasElement; AList: TList); procedure AddList(AElement: TPasElement; AList: TFPList);
var var
i: Integer; i: Integer;
begin begin
@ -1722,7 +1722,7 @@ begin
Result:=CompareText(TPasElement(P1).Name,TPasElement(P2).Name); Result:=CompareText(TPasElement(P1).Name,TPasElement(P2).Name);
end; end;
procedure TManWriter.SortElementList(List : TList); procedure TManWriter.SortElementList(List : TFPList);
begin begin
List.Sort(@CompareElements); List.Sort(@CompareElements);

View File

@ -34,7 +34,7 @@ Type
// Auxiliary routines // Auxiliary routines
procedure DescrBeginURL(const AURL: DOMString); override; // Provides a default implementation procedure DescrBeginURL(const AURL: DOMString); override; // Provides a default implementation
procedure DescrEndURL; override; procedure DescrEndURL; override;
procedure SortElementList(List : TList); procedure SortElementList(List : TFPList);
procedure StartListing(Frames: Boolean); procedure StartListing(Frames: Boolean);
Function ShowMember(M : TPasElement) : boolean; Function ShowMember(M : TPasElement) : boolean;
procedure StartChapter(ChapterName : String; ChapterLabel : String); virtual; procedure StartChapter(ChapterName : String; ChapterLabel : String); virtual;
@ -1154,7 +1154,7 @@ begin
Result:=CompareText(TPasElement(P1).Name,TPasElement(P2).Name); Result:=CompareText(TPasElement(P1).Name,TPasElement(P2).Name);
end; end;
procedure TLinearWriter.SortElementList(List : TList); procedure TLinearWriter.SortElementList(List : TFPList);
begin begin
List.Sort(@CompareElements); List.Sort(@CompareElements);
@ -1229,7 +1229,7 @@ constructor TLinearWriter.Create(APackage: TPasPackage; AEngine: TFPDocEngine);
Engine.AddLink(AElement.PathName, GetLabel(AElement)); Engine.AddLink(AElement.PathName, GetLabel(AElement));
end; end;
procedure AddList(AElement: TPasElement; AList: TList); procedure AddList(AElement: TPasElement; AList: TFPList);
var var
i: Integer; i: Integer;
begin begin